Hero Vishal has been trying hard to score a big hit in Tollywood since Pandemkodi and now he arrived with a complete mass movie. The movie has hit the theaters across the Telugu states on Friday. The film is the dubbed version of the Tamil action film Marudhu, which was released in theatres in Tamil Nadu on May 20.
Story:
Rayudu (Vishal) is a daily wage worker who works in a local market yard. He stays with his grandmother Aanama (Leela) and he obeys whatever she asks as she was raised by her. she asks Rayudu to get married to Bhagyalakshmi (Sri Divya). Rayudu agreed to Aanama's request and goes after Bhagyam.
As the days passed on, Rayudu comes to know that a local ruthless goon Rolex Batchi(R K Suresh) wanted to eliminate Bhagyam in connection with a case. Rayudu stands by the Bhagyam and lock horns with Rolex.How will he face Rolex? Why is the villain troubling Bhagyam? forms the rest of the story.
Performances:
The roles like this are a cakewalk for Vishal and his complete involvement is clearly visible in the every frame. Vishal has done a brilliant job in this movie and his performance is a big asset.
He has once again proved that he is very comfortable in action stunts.
Coming to the leading lady Sri Divya, she impresses with her natural looks. She has delivered a very good performance in all the crucial scenes. The chemistry between Vishal and Sri Divya is a treat for the mass audience. Kokkoroko Suri's comedy brings much laughs. RK Suresh makes a good impressions as the villain. Others have excelled in their roles.
Technical:
Imman's songs are good and but full marks should be given for background score. Cinematography is rich and he captures locations of villages beautifully. Pace of the movie is slow in the second half.
Had the editor chopped off some scenes in the second half and emotional scenes in particular, it would have made the film more gripping.

Analysis:
Vishal Reddy has once again manages to come up with a complete mass entertainer. The story of Rayudu may be routine but it will definitely hold the attention of the mass audience.
The emotional scenes between Rayudu and his grandmother are ok but they are stretched beyond a point. The director could not able to give punch to the twists as they become highly predictable. The screenplay was having many hiccups. The movie has some high octane action scenes and they go well with the mass audience. Climax scene was executed very well.
Class audience may feel it boring. For those who are looking for a complete mass film, Rayudu is the perfect movie.
Overall, the story is simple but the presentation which was packed with the right ingredients for a mass entertainer.
